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Антильский сумеречный козодой | Kosrae Flying Fox |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(животные) | Animalia (животные)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(хордовые) | Chordata (хордовые) |
| Class | Aves (птицы) | Mammalia (млекопитающие) |
| Order | Caprimulgiformes (козодоеобразные) | Chiroptera (рукокрылые) |
| Family | Caprimulgidae | Pteropodidae (Fruit Bats) |
| Genus | Chordeiles | Pteropus (Flying Foxes) |
| Species | Chordeiles gundlachii | Pteropus ualanus |
Evolutionary Relationship
Антильский сумеречный козодой and Kosrae Flying Fox share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(хордовые)
